Alex Towle, Jr. 100 ½, passed away Saturday, February 7, 2026 at Silver Fox Nursing Home in McLeansboro, IL.
Alex was born August 6, 1925 near Walpole, IL. He was a son of Alex M. Towle and Julia A. Towle. He married Elizabeth (Lizzie) Lampley on November 29, 1947. She preceded him in death in 2011. He married Betty Gene (Renschler) Drake on June 10, 2011. Betty preceded him in death in 2023.
Alex was a member of the Hopewell Baptist Church for 74 years. And a 74 year member of the Polk AF & AM Masonic Lodge and also a lifetime member of the VFW. He owned and operated the Tie-On Roofing Company for 35 years. He was in the Galatia High School class of 1943. He served in the US Army in 1944 and spent time in Italy with the 686th Ordinance of the 5th Army Unit. Alex was the oldest living WWII Veteran in Hamilton County. He loved anything concerning horses and ponies and took great pride building wagons for them which can be found across the United States!
Alex is survived by several nieces and nephews and very special friends Craig and Connie Miller.
Alex was preceded in death by parents, wives Elizabeth and Betty, and five brothers and five sisters.
